Details
In this magical story, a scientist sets out to prove that reindeer can fly and along the way discovers the true meaning of faith, family and Christmas.
Cast & Crew
- Richard Thomas , Beau Bridges , Maria Pitillo , Jan Rubeš , Debbie Lee Carrington , Taylor Reid , Meghan Black , James Kirk
- Ian Barry